Longtime White House correspondent Helen Thomas is miffed at Garry Trudeau after he portrayed her as one tough broad in his Doonesbury cartoon strip last week.
But it’s not because he depicted the dean of the White House press corps telling self-important TV correspondent Roland Hedley to “Get the hell out of my face” when he brought two visitors to meet her in the White House briefing room.
No, it was because Hedley told the visitors the “legendary UPI reporter
been here since the Truman administration! Some say she was Truman’s lover.”
Truman’s lover? Puh-lease. Thomas likes to think she could do better than that.
“I wish he’d said I was Jack Kennedy’s lover,” said Thomas, who began covering the White House when President Kennedy took office in January, 1961.
Thomas, who will celebrate her 87th birthday next month, left UPI in 2000 and now writes a syndicated column for Hearst Newspapers.
